Arne Slot statement on Diogo Jota officially released

Liverpool manager, Arne Slot has spoken for the first time after the shocking passing of Diogo Jota.

The 28-year-old striker and his brother died in the early hours of  Thursday in a devastating car crash.

The striker, it has been gathered, had undergone a pulmonary surgery and was advised by the doctors not to fly.



As such, he was on his way to getting a ferry in Spain when the incident happened.



Amid the shock, there has been several tributes from fans and former teammates.

Arne Slot, under whose guidance Jota made 37 appearances and scored nine times has now spoken out on the striker’s death.

“What to say?” Slot began in a statement released on the club’s official website.

What can anyone say at a time like this when the shock and the pain is so incredibly raw?

They are of a father, a son, a brother and an uncle and they belong to the family of Diogo and Andre Silva who have experienced such an unimaginable loss.

My message to them is very clear – you will never walk alone.

In many ways, it was a dream summer for Diogo and his family, which makes it all the more heartbreaking that it should end like this.

When I first came to the club, one of the first songs I got to know was the one that our fans sing for Diogo.

I had not worked with him previously but I knew straight away that if the Liverpool supporters, who have seen so many great players over the years, had such a unique chant for Diogo, he must have special qualities.

That we have lost those qualities in such terrible circumstances is something we have not yet come to terms with.

We owe this to Diogo, to Andre Silva, to their wider family and to ourselves.

My condolences go to Diogo’s wife, Rute, their three beautiful children and to the parents of Diogo and Andre Silva.

When the time is right, we will celebrate Diogo Jota, we will remember his goals and we will sing his song.

He will never be forgotten.

His name is Diogo.
